description Hand is an important parts of human physical bodies that have high complex structure with highest precision, flexibility and accurate movement involve a lot of numbers nerve connected. Amputees are people who have difficulties when dealing with their routine or daily life activities because of physical problem. This project to focus on the designing the prosthetic hand consist of the intelligent controller based on the multiple rule that having capabilities to operate on fuzzy logic control algorithms for amputees. This project utilized fuzzy logic controller to control the positioning of prosthetic hand as feedback input to provide the membership rule in fuzzy logic control algorithm. The results show that the designed controller has good capabilities to accurately control the prosthetic hand system.
